19-Year-Old Olympia Man Killed in Head-On Collision

Thurston County -- Wednesday evening at approximately 5:17 p.m., 19-year-old Joseph P. Bidot of Olympia was killed in a collision at the 8400 block of Yelm Highway SE.  Bidot was driving a 1994 Honda Prelude eastbound on Yelm Highway when he crossed the double yellow centerline and struck a 2007 Chrysler PT Cruiser head-on.  Bidot was pronounced deceased at the collision scene by medical personnel.

The driver of the PT Cruiser is a 32-year-old Tumwater man. He was transported to Providence St. Peter Hospital with serious injuries.  Alcohol and/or drugs do not appear to be factors, and both drivers were wearing their seatbelts.  The cause of the collision is still under investigation.

This tragic collision hits very close to home for the Washington State Patrol family. Joseph P. Bidot is the younger brother of Yakima area trooper, Pedro Bidot. Our thoughts are with Trooper Bidot and his family, as well as the Tumwater man injured in this terrible accident.
